Looks like `DeclContext::isTransparentContext()` might be relevant here. At 
least I was able to get the assertion failure

> Assertion failed: (II && "Attempt to mangle unnamed decl."), function 
> getMangledNameImpl, file llvm-project/clang/lib/CodeGen/CodeGenModule.cpp, 
> line 913.

for
```lang=c++
// clang -std=c++17 -fmodules-ts test-modules.cpp

export module M;
export {
    union {
        int int_val;
        float float_val;
    };
}
```

Also based on `isTransparentContext()` usage, inline namespaces can cause 
problems. Currently, there are no problems, we have the error

> error: anonymous unions at namespace or global scope must be declared 'static'

and there are no negative consequences (as far as I can tell). According to my 
bad standard knowledge that should be OK (haven't found non-static anonymous 
unions to be allowed in this case).

Checked if we need to do the same change s/Owner/OwnerScope/ elsewhere in this 
method and looks like it is not required. We care if the owner is a Record and 
we don't allow linkage specification in classes, so skipping linkage scopes 
doesn't give us anything.
